72547 is a odd prime number that follows 72546 and precedes 72548. As a prime number, 72547 is only divisible by 1 and itself. It holds a unique position in the sequence of integers. Its prime factorization is simply 72547. 72547 is classified as a deficient number based on the sum of its proper divisors. In computer science, 72547 is represented as 10001101101100011 in binary and 11B63 in hexadecimal.
